Poha Potato Rice
Preparation time is 10minutes
Cook time is 20minutes
Total time is 30minutes
Serve is for 4 people
Difficulty level: 2 out of 4
12 Ingredients
Number of servings
4
- 600grams potatoes, peeled and chopped into cubes
- 140grams rice flakes, rinsedingredient tip
- 2tablespoons olive oil
- 1 pinch asafoetida
- 1teaspoons black mustard seeds
- 1teaspoons cumin
- 1 medium red chilli, diced
- 10 curry leaves, crushed
- 1/2 medium red onion, peeled and diced
- 1/2 bunch coriander, fresh, chopped
- 1 medium lime, chopped into wedges
- 1teaspoons caster sugar
Description
Rice flakes and spiced potatoes make up hearty poha, a popular Indian breakfast dish.
Method
Step 1 of 3
Place the potatoes in a large pan of boiling water and cook for 10 minutes and drain well. Soak the rice flakes in a bowl of water for 2 minutes and drain well.
Step 2 of 3
Heat the oil in a large pan on medium high heat and heat the mustard seeds until they begin to pop. Add the curry leaves, cumin, chillis and asafoetida and tip in the potatoes and onion. Cook for 3-4 minutes.
Step 3 of 3
Tip in the rice flakes and sugar and cook for 3-4 minutes, stirring well throughout. Serve with fresh coriander on top and lime wedges on the side.
